How does HPE Mist Access Assurance differ from traditional network access control (NAC)?
Network access control (NAC) is a decades-old security technology for network device onboarding and policy management. However, traditional NAC suffers from architectural challenges. For example, the explosion of different unattended device types, complexities of disaggregated networks, and on-premises NAC implementations expose ever-increasing risks and vulnerabilities.
The cloud-native HPE Mist Access Assurance solution solves these problems by verifying the following information before allowing a device to connect:
- Who is trying to connect (determined using identity fingerprinting and user context).
- Where the connection is originating, such as a specific site or VLAN.
- What permissions and other access policies are associated with the user and the device attempting to connect.
- How the user/device is attempting to establish access and what type of network connection they are using.
What is 802.1X authentication?
802.1X is an Ethernet LAN authentication protocol used to provide secure access to a computer network. It's a standard defined by the Institute of Electrical and Electronics Engineers (IEEE) for port-based network access control. As such, its main purpose is to verify that a device attempting to connect to the network is actually what it claims to be. 802.1X is commonly used in enterprise networks to protect against unauthorized access, enforce security policies, and make sure that data transmitted over the network is secure.
What is MAC Authentication Bypass (MAB)?
MAB is a network access control protocol that bases a grant or deny decision exclusively on the endpoint's media access control (MAC) address. It's often used within the context of a larger, standard 802.1X authentication framework for the subset of devices that don't support 802.1X client, or supplicant, software, such as M2M/IoT and BYOD devices.
What is OpenRoaming on HPE Mist?
OpenRoaming on HPE Mist enables users to connect automatically and securely to participating Wi-Fi networks using trusted identity credentials, creating a more seamless experience across locations. Built on standards-based technologies such as Passpoint and secure roaming frameworks, extend secure guest and public Wi-Fi access without repeated logins.
What is the Sandbox / "Dry Run" feature on HPE Mist?
The "Dry Run" capabilities within HPE Mist Access Assurance allow policies to be validated against actual conditions and to assess true impact before deployment, reducing risk, enabling zero trust, and ensuring operational continuity.

Is there an external directory services support
Yes, Access Assurance provides authentication services by integrating external directory services, such as Google Workspace, Microsoft Azure Active Directory, Okta Workforce Identity, and others. It also integrates external Public Key Infrastructure (PKI) and MDM/UEM platforms.
